In the rapidly evolving landscape of technology, the concept of Multi-Experience Development Platforms (MXDPs) has emerged as a pivotal innovation. These platforms are designed to facilitate the creation of applications that provide seamless user experiences across a multitude of devices and interaction modalities. Unlike traditional development environments that focus primarily on single-channel applications, MXDPs enable developers to build solutions that can be accessed via web browsers, mobile devices, wearables, and even augmented or virtual reality interfaces.
This holistic approach to application development is essential in an era where users expect consistent and engaging experiences, regardless of the device they are using. The rise of MXDPs can be attributed to the increasing complexity of user interactions and the diverse range of devices available today. As consumers engage with brands through various touchpoints, from smartphones to smart home devices, the need for a unified experience has never been more critical.
MXDPs address this challenge by providing a framework that allows developers to create applications that are not only functional but also adaptable to different contexts and user preferences. By leveraging these platforms, organisations can ensure that their applications remain relevant and user-friendly in an ever-changing digital landscape.
Summary
- Multi-Experience Development Platforms enable developers to create apps for multiple devices and platforms using a single codebase.
- The benefits of Multi-Experience Development Platforms include faster time to market, cost savings, and improved user experience.
- Key features of Multi-Experience Development Platforms include cross-platform compatibility, reusable components, and built-in security features.
- Multi-Experience Development Platforms are revolutionizing app development by streamlining the process and increasing efficiency.
- When choosing the right Multi-Experience Development Platform, consider factors such as scalability, integration capabilities, and developer support.
The Benefits of Multi-Experience Development Platforms
The advantages of adopting Multi-Experience Development Platforms are manifold, particularly for organisations seeking to enhance their digital offerings. One of the most significant benefits is the ability to streamline the development process. By utilising a single platform to create applications for multiple channels, developers can reduce redundancy and minimise the time spent on coding and testing.
This efficiency translates into faster time-to-market for new features and updates, allowing businesses to respond swiftly to market demands and user feedback. Moreover, MXDPs foster greater collaboration among development teams. With integrated tools for design, development, and deployment, team members can work more cohesively, sharing insights and resources in real-time.
This collaborative environment not only enhances productivity but also encourages innovation, as developers can experiment with new ideas without the constraints typically associated with siloed development processes. Additionally, the use of pre-built components and templates within MXDPs can significantly lower the barrier to entry for organisations looking to adopt advanced technologies, enabling them to leverage cutting-edge capabilities without extensive expertise.
Key Features of Multi-Experience Development Platforms
Multi-Experience Development Platforms come equipped with a variety of features designed to support the creation of versatile applications. One of the hallmark features is the ability to create responsive designs that automatically adjust to different screen sizes and orientations. This ensures that users have a consistent experience whether they are accessing an application on a smartphone, tablet, or desktop computer.
The emphasis on responsive design is crucial in today’s mobile-first world, where users expect applications to function seamlessly across devices. Another critical feature of MXDPs is their support for various interaction modalities. This includes not only traditional touch interfaces but also voice commands, gestures, and even visual recognition technologies.
By accommodating these diverse interaction methods, MXDPs empower developers to create more inclusive applications that cater to a broader audience. Furthermore, many platforms offer robust analytics tools that provide insights into user behaviour across different channels. This data-driven approach enables organisations to refine their applications continually, ensuring they meet user needs effectively.
How Multi-Experience Development Platforms are Revolutionizing App Development
The advent of Multi-Experience Development Platforms is fundamentally transforming the app development landscape. Traditionally, developers faced significant challenges when attempting to create applications that functioned well across multiple devices and platforms. The fragmentation of user experiences often led to inconsistencies and frustrations for end-users.
However, MXDPs have introduced a paradigm shift by providing a unified framework that simplifies the development process while enhancing user engagement. One notable aspect of this revolution is the increased focus on user-centric design principles. MXDPs encourage developers to prioritise the user experience from the outset, integrating feedback loops that allow for continuous improvement based on real-world usage patterns.
This iterative approach not only leads to higher-quality applications but also fosters stronger relationships between brands and their customers. As organisations embrace this shift towards multi-experience development, they are better positioned to meet the evolving expectations of users who demand personalised and engaging interactions.
Choosing the Right Multi-Experience Development Platform for Your Needs
Selecting an appropriate Multi-Experience Development Platform requires careful consideration of several factors tailored to an organisation’s specific needs. One of the primary considerations is scalability; as businesses grow and evolve, their application requirements may change significantly. Therefore, it is essential to choose a platform that can accommodate future expansion without necessitating a complete overhaul of existing systems.
Another critical factor is integration capabilities. Many organisations rely on a variety of third-party services and tools to enhance their operations. A robust MXDP should offer seamless integration with these external systems, allowing for a cohesive ecosystem that maximises efficiency and functionality.
Additionally, organisations should evaluate the level of support and resources available from the platform provider. Comprehensive documentation, training materials, and responsive customer support can significantly impact the success of an implementation.
The Future of Multi-Experience Development Platforms
As technology continues to advance at an unprecedented pace, the future of Multi-Experience Development Platforms appears promising yet complex. Emerging technologies such as artificial intelligence (AI) and machine learning (ML) are poised to play a significant role in shaping the capabilities of MXDPs. By incorporating AI-driven insights into user behaviour and preferences, these platforms can facilitate even more personalised experiences that adapt in real-time to individual users.
Moreover, as the Internet of Things (IoT) expands its reach into everyday life, MXDPs will need to evolve to accommodate an increasing number of connected devices. This will require platforms to support not only traditional application interfaces but also new modalities such as smart home devices and wearables. The integration of augmented reality (AR) and virtual reality (VR) into MXDPs will further enhance user experiences by providing immersive interactions that were previously unimaginable.
Case Studies: Successful Implementation of Multi-Experience Development Platforms
Several organisations have successfully harnessed the power of Multi-Experience Development Platforms to enhance their digital offerings and improve customer engagement. For instance, a leading retail brand implemented an MXDP to unify its online and offline shopping experiences. By creating a single application accessible via mobile devices and in-store kiosks, the brand was able to provide customers with personalised recommendations based on their shopping history and preferences.
This integration not only improved customer satisfaction but also resulted in increased sales as users were more likely to engage with tailored promotions. Another compelling case study involves a healthcare provider that adopted an MXDP to streamline patient interactions across various channels. By developing a comprehensive application that allowed patients to schedule appointments, access medical records, and communicate with healthcare professionals through multiple devices, the provider significantly improved patient engagement and satisfaction rates.
The platform’s analytics capabilities enabled the organisation to identify trends in patient behaviour, leading to more effective outreach strategies and improved health outcomes.
Tips for Getting Started with Multi-Experience Development Platforms
Embarking on the journey towards adopting a Multi-Experience Development Platform can be daunting; however, several strategies can facilitate a smoother transition. First and foremost, organisations should conduct a thorough assessment of their current digital landscape. Understanding existing pain points and user needs will provide valuable insights into what features are essential in an MXDP.
Engaging stakeholders from various departments during the selection process is also crucial. Input from marketing, IT, customer service, and other relevant teams can help ensure that the chosen platform aligns with organisational goals and user expectations. Additionally, organisations should consider starting with a pilot project before fully committing to an MXDP.
This approach allows teams to test the platform’s capabilities in a controlled environment while gathering feedback that can inform future development efforts. Investing in training for development teams is another vital step in ensuring successful implementation. Familiarity with the platform’s features and best practices will empower developers to maximise its potential effectively.
Finally, organisations should remain open to iterating on their applications based on user feedback post-launch; this commitment to continuous improvement will ultimately lead to more successful outcomes in the long run.
Multi-Experience Development Platforms are essential tools for businesses looking to enhance their digital presence and engage with customers across various channels. In a recent article on how online catalogues can grow your ecommerce business, the importance of providing a seamless and interactive shopping experience is highlighted. By utilising multi-experience development platforms, businesses can create user-friendly catalogues that cater to the needs and preferences of their customers, ultimately driving sales and boosting brand loyalty. Additionally, conducting a small business risk assessment, as discussed in another article on how to conduct a small business risk assessment, can help businesses identify potential threats and opportunities in the market, allowing them to make informed decisions and mitigate risks effectively.
FAQs
What are Multi-Experience Development Platforms (MXDPs)?
Multi-Experience Development Platforms (MXDPs) are software development tools that enable developers to create applications for multiple types of devices and interfaces, such as mobile phones, tablets, wearables, and IoT devices.
What are the key features of Multi-Experience Development Platforms?
Key features of Multi-Experience Development Platforms include cross-platform compatibility, support for various user interfaces (such as touch, voice, and gesture), integration with backend systems, and tools for rapid application development.
How do Multi-Experience Development Platforms differ from traditional development platforms?
Multi-Experience Development Platforms differ from traditional development platforms in that they are designed to support the creation of applications that can be used across a wide range of devices and interfaces, rather than being limited to a specific platform or device type.
What are the benefits of using Multi-Experience Development Platforms?
The benefits of using Multi-Experience Development Platforms include reduced development time and cost, the ability to reach a wider audience with a single application, and the flexibility to adapt to new and emerging technologies and devices.
What are some examples of Multi-Experience Development Platforms?
Examples of Multi-Experience Development Platforms include Microsoft PowerApps, Mendix, OutSystems, and Salesforce Lightning Platform. These platforms offer a range of tools and features for building multi-experience applications.